Allyson Felix wins 11th medal, more than any other U.S. athlete in Olympic track history
CBSN
Allyson Felix, who became the most-decorated woman in Olympic track history when she won bronze in the 400 on Friday night, now passes Carl Lewis with the most track medals of any U.S. athlete. Of her 11 medals, seven are gold.
Felix combined with her American teammates to finish the 4x400-meter relay in 3 minutes, 16.85 seconds for a runaway victory.
